		Conceptual Parameters
- Baseplate
 
- 2 Fixed Blocks (mounted to baseplate by XXX, 2 shaft holes, 1 threaded rod hole)
 
- 1 Moving Nut Block (rides on 2 shafts, driven by a threaded rod that moves a nut welded to the block)
 
- 2 Shafts (radially held on the Fixed Blocks, axially held by 2 shaft couplings on the outsides of the Fixed Blocks)
 
- 1 Threaded Rod (radially held on the Fixed Blocks, axially held by 2 shaft couplings on the outsides of the Fixed Blocks, drives a nut welded to the Moving Block)
 
- 1 Clamp Handle (welded to the Threaded Rod)
 
Clamp Threaded Rod and Shafts Positioning
- The Threaded Rod and Shafts for the clamp must be inserted through holes propagated along a common centerline. Common centerline positioning provides the highest possible power transfer that can be attained through the 2 shaft 1 threaded rod system- because disjointed positioning can cause force vectors not along the clamping axis of motion.
